Output 81aba98682c79a4a1fc3348cb842e883afa3abc7ac589530803b87f3b611e882:1

value
37760000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c1ecd36dc38a197dbb70a7004601d538135757e OP_EQUAL
address
ACWADj5qwBFXJz9wDPeFGixBwhLvqsC4tm
transaction
81aba98682c79a4a1fc3348cb842e883afa3abc7ac589530803b87f3b611e882